Carbon Offset - A Great Way To Save The Environment

As the planet tries to deal with the grave threats posed by air pollutants and greenhouse gases, carbon offset is providing an incentive to encourage governments and companies to keep carbon emissions within reasonable limits.

Carbon offset is a method of decreasing the emission of harmful greenhouse gases by using different ways like continuous reforestation initiatives, alternative and renewable energy supply etc. The greenhouse gas emission caps for developed and emerging nations are governed by the Kyoto Protocol, an internationally recognized pact, which was ratified in 2005 by almost all nations of the world.

The Protocol makes it mandatory for industries emitting above the allowed limit of carbon dioxide to bring down their emissions to prescribed levels, or they should buy carbon credits certificates which can be transacted in the market, or alternatively pay a charge for the emissions, which is referred to as carbon tax. Carbon credits, which were conceived before carbon offset, are the most preferred and cheap option for manufacturing businesses releasing more than the allowed limit of greenhouse gases, with one credit equal to 1000 kilograms of carbon dioxide released into the air. Both multinational and local companies, to make their operations carbon neutral and improve their image before clients and investors, are increasingly purchasing carbon credits.

Ambitious ecological projects around the world that are working towards the overall reduction of CO2’s hazardous influence on the environment are now also being aided by the carbon offset system, which finances several of these projects. It therefore aids in promoting environmental programmes related to reforestation, conservation of resources, and green energy alternatives like wind energy, solar energy, geothermal energy, etc.

Ordinary people are also using this method and are buying carbon offset to make the environment cleaner and to generate awareness about environment conservation. Carbon offset can be conveniently purchased online through one of the many providers, but caution must be taken to make sure that your funds are invested in the correct projects.
